蜕皮甾酮 是由露水草用多种色谱技术分离提取的植物纯天然有机化合物。
东北多足蕨根茎含蜕皮素(ecdysone),蜕皮甾酮(ecdysterone),22(29)-何帕烯,17(21)-何帕烯,7-羊齿烯,8-羊齿烯(fern-8-ene),9(11)-羊齿烯,14-千层塔烯,18(28),21-达玛二烯,13(17),...
